About

Camp Good Grief is a bereavement day camp where children and teenagers take part in group therapy, art therapy, and music therapy. Campers also join in sports, swimming, arts and crafts, and exploring nature. Each afternoon includes a special event that is planned to bring the day to a close with fun and excitement, and activities are designed to provide age-appropriate information about grief while balancing work with fun and forging new friendships.

• Ages: 5–18 years old
• Price: Camp is provided free of charge thanks to our generous donors.

Camp Good Grief is a program of East End Hospice, which was founded in 1991. The camp is limited to 150 campers, and priority is given to first-time campers. Its mission is to bring children and teens who are grieving together in a caring and supportive environment. All Camp Good Grief therapists are licensed in their specialty and have many years of clinical experience, including advanced practice social workers, psychologists, and art and music therapists who have undergone extensive training by East End Hospice in the treatment of children’s grief. Volunteers complete hours of training and spend a year or more working under the supervision of social workers helping to co-lead children’s bereavement groups. The Camp Director is Angela Byrns, LCSW, who also serves as the Children’s Bereavement Coordinator for East End Hospice. East End Hospice is a NYS Certified Hospice serving the East End of Long Island, including The Hamptons and the Eastern Suffolk County Townships of Brookhaven, Riverhead, Southold, Shelter Island, Southampton, and East Hampton. A Camp Good Grief participant described the experience by saying, “It makes me feel a lot better that everyone in this room has lost someone and they all know how I feel.”
